  • In this paper, we define the weak dimension and the chain-weak dimension of an ordered set by using weak orders and chain-weak orders, respectively, as realizers. First, we prove that if P is not a weak order, then the weak dimension of P is the same as the dimension of P. Next, we determine the chain-weak dimension of the product of k-element chains. Finally, we prove some properties of chain-weak dimension which hold for dimension.

  • 미분 가능한 함수가 독립변수의 각 점에서 미분계수를 가지듯이 가장 일반화된 Cantor집합의 각 점에서 weak local dimension 을 갖는다. 이러한 weak local dimension 은 두 가지가 있는데 weak lower local dimension 과 weak upper local dimension 이 있다 weak lower local dimension 은 국소적인 의미로 perturbed Cantor 집합의 lower Cantor dimension 이고 Hausdorff dimension 과 관련이 있다. weak upper local dimension 은 국소적인 의미로 perturbed Cantor 집합의 upper Cantor dimension 이고 packing dimension 과 관련이 있다. 이때 각 점에 대응하는 유관한 측도는 quasi-self-similar measure 이며 그 점의 weak lower local dimension 이 s 이면 그 점의 s-차원 quasi-self-similar measure 의 lower local dimension 이 s 가 된다. 마찬가지로 그 점의 weak upper local dimension 이 s 이면 그 점의 s-차원 quasi-self-similar measure 의 upper local dimension 이 s 가 된다. 따라서 이와 같은 사실을 이용하면 가장 일반화된 Cantor집합의 각 점에서의 weak local dimension 을 이용하여 그 집합의 Hausdorff 또는 packing 차원의 정보를 얻을 수 있을 뿐 더러 weak local dimension 을 이용한 spectrum 을 또한 구할 수 있다. 한편 weak local dimension 과 유관한 quasi-self-similar measure 는 집합의 spectrum을 생성하며 이 spectrum 을 이루는 각 부분집합의 차원에 대하여 보다 좋은 정보를 주는 transformed dimension 과 또 다른 관련을 갖게 된다.

  • A deranged Cantor set (without the uniform bounded-ness condition away from zero of contraction ratios) whose weak local dimensions for all points coincide has its Hausdorff dimension of the same value of weak local dimension. We will show it using an energy theory instead of Frostman's density lemma which was used for the case of the deranged Cantor set with the uniform boundedness condition of contraction ratios. In the end, we will give an example of such a deranged Cantor set.

  • In this article, we introduce and study the Gorenstein cotorsion dimension of modules and rings. It is shown that this dimension has nice properties when the ring in question is left GF-closed. The relations between the Gorenstein cotorsion dimension and other homological dimensions are discussed. Finally, we give some new characterizations of weak Gorenstein global dimension of coherent rings in terms of Gorenstein cotorsion modules.

  • In this paper, we introduce and study the w-weak global dimension w-w.gl.dim(R) of a commutative ring R. As an application, it is shown that an integral domain R is a $Pr\ddot{u}fer$ v-multiplication domain if and only if w-w.gl.dim(R) ${\leq}1$. We also show that there is a large class of domains in which Hilbert's syzygy Theorem for the w-weak global dimension does not hold. Namely, we prove that if R is an integral domain (but not a field) for which the polynomial ring R[x] is w-coherent, then w-w.gl.dim(R[x]) = w-w.gl.dim(R).

  • We defined Cantor dimensions of a perturbed Cantor set, and investigated a relation between these dimensions and Hausdorff and packing dimensions of a perturbed Cantor set. In this paper, we introduce another expressions of the Cantor dimensions. Using these, we study some informations which can be derived from power equations induced from contraction ratios of a perturbed Cantor set to give its Hausdorff or packing dimension. This application to a deranged Cantor set gives us an estimation of its Hausdorff and packing dimensions, which is a generalization of the Cantor dimension theorem.

  • We find a regularity criterion for the Ostwald-de Waele models like Serrin's condition to the Navier-Stokes equations. Moreover, we show short time existence and estimate the Hausdorff dimension of the set of singular times for the weak solutions.

  • In this paper, we introduce and study regular rings relative to the hereditary torsion theory w (a special case of a well-centered torsion theory over a commutative ring), called w-regular rings. We focus mainly on the w-regularity for w-coherent rings and w-Noetherian rings. In particular, it is shown that the w-coherent w-regular domains are exactly the Prüfer v-multiplication domains and that an integral domain is w-Noetherian and w-regular if and only if it is a Krull domain. We also prove the w-analogue of the global version of the Serre-Auslander-Buchsbaum Theorem. Among other things, we show that every w-Noetherian w-regular ring is the direct sum of a finite number of Krull domains. Finally, we obtain that the global weak w-projective dimension of a w-Noetherian ring is 0, 1, or ∞.
